#include
#include
#include
#include "x11twind.h"
#ifndef BSD
#define bzero(d,n) (void)memset(d,0,n)
#endif
#define checkcurs(t) if ((t)->cursor) togglecurs(t)
#define restorecurs checkcurs
/* width/height of a character in fontstruct f */
#define Width(f) ((f)->max_bounds.rbearing - (f)->min_bounds.lbearing)
#define Height(f) ((f)->ascent + (f)->descent)
#define YStart(f) ((f)->ascent)
static void togglecurs();
TEXTWIND *
xt_open(dpy, parent, x, y, width, height, bw, fore, back, fontname)
Display *dpy;
Window parent;
int x, y;
int width, height;
int bw;
unsigned long fore, back;
char *fontname;
{
register int i;
register TEXTWIND *t;
if ((t = (TEXTWIND *)malloc(sizeof(TEXTWIND))) == NULL)
return(NULL);
t->dpy = dpy;
t->w = XCreateSimpleWindow(dpy, parent, x, y, width, height,
bw, fore, back);
if (t->w == 0)
return(NULL);
XMapWindow(dpy, t->w);
if ((t->f = XLoadQueryFont(dpy, fontname)) == 0)
return(NULL);
/* if (!t->f.fixedwidth) check for fixedwidth later
return(NULL); */
t->gc = XCreateGC(dpy,t->w,0,NULL);
XSetState(dpy, t->gc, fore, back, GXcopy, AllPlanes);
XSetFont(dpy, t->gc, t->f->fid);
t->nc = (width - LEFTMAR) /
Width(t->f); /* number of columns */
t->nr = height /
Height(t->f); /* number of rows */
if (t->nc < 1 || t->nr < 1)
return(NULL);
if ((t->lp = (char **)calloc(t->nr, sizeof(char *))) == NULL)
return(NULL);
for (i = 0; i < t->nr; i++)
if ((t->lp[i] = calloc(t->nc+1, 1)) == NULL)
return(NULL);
t->r = t->c = 0;
t->cursor = TNOCURS;
return(t);
}
void
xt_puts(s, t) /* output a string */
register char *s;
TEXTWIND *t;
{
int oldcurs;
oldcurs = xt_cursor(t, TNOCURS); /* for efficiency */
while (*s)
xt_putc(*s++, t);
xt_cursor(t, oldcurs);
}
void
xt_putc(c, t) /* output a character */
char c;
register TEXTWIND *t;
{
checkcurs(t);
switch (c) {
case '\n':
if (t->r >= t->nr - 1)
xt_delete(t, 0); /* scroll up 1 line */
else if (t->r < t->nr - 1)
t->r++;
/* fall through */
case '\r':
t->c = 0;
break;
case '\b':
while (t->c < 1 && t->r > 0)
t->c = strlen(t->lp[--t->r]);
if (t->c > 0)
t->c--;
break;
default:
if (t->c >= t->nc)
xt_putc('\n', t);
XDrawImageString(t->dpy, t->w, t->gc, LEFTMAR+t->c*Width(t->f),
YStart(t->f)+t->r*Height(t->f), &c, 1);
t->lp[t->r][t->c++] = c;
break;
}
restorecurs(t);
}
void
xt_delete(t, r) /* delete a line */
register TEXTWIND *t;
int r;
{
char *cp;
register int i;
if (r < 0 || r >= t->nr)
return;
checkcurs(t);
/* move lines */
XCopyArea(t->dpy, t->w, t->w, t->gc, LEFTMAR, (r+1)*Height(t->f),
t->nc*Width(t->f), (t->nr-1-r)*Height(t->f),
LEFTMAR, r*Height(t->f));
cp = t->lp[r];
for (i = r; i < t->nr-1; i++)
t->lp[i] = t->lp[i+1];
t->lp[t->nr-1] = cp;
/* clear bottom */
XClearArea(t->dpy, t->w, LEFTMAR, (t->nr-1)*Height(t->f),
t->nc*Width(t->f), Height(t->f),(Bool) 0);
bzero(cp, t->nc);
restorecurs(t); /* should we reposition cursor? */
}
void
xt_insert(t, r) /* insert a line */
register TEXTWIND *t;
int r;
{
char *cp;
register int i;
if (r < 0 || r >= t->nr)
return;
checkcurs(t);
/* move lines */
XCopyArea(t->dpy, t->w, t->w, t->gc, LEFTMAR, r*Height(t->f), LEFTMAR,
(r+1)*Height(t->f), t->nc*Width(t->f),
(t->nr-1-r)*Height(t->f));
cp = t->lp[t->nr-1];
for (i = t->nr-1; i > r; i--)
t->lp[i] = t->lp[i-1];
t->lp[r] = cp;
/* clear new line */
XClearArea(t->dpy, t->w, LEFTMAR, r*Height(t->f),
t->nc*Width(t->f), Height(t->f), (Bool) 0);
bzero(cp, t->nc);
restorecurs(t); /* should we reposition cursor? */
}
void
xt_redraw(t) /* redraw text window */
register TEXTWIND *t;
{
register int i;
XClearWindow(t->dpy, t->w);
for (i = 0; i < t->nr; i++)
if (strlen(t->lp[i]) > 0)
XDrawImageString(t->dpy, t->w, t->gc, LEFTMAR,
YStart(t->f)+i*Height(t->f),
t->lp[i], strlen(t->lp[i]));
restorecurs(t);
}
void
xt_clear(t) /* clear text window */
register TEXTWIND *t;
{
register int i;
XClearWindow(t->dpy, t->w);
for (i = 0; i < t->nr; i++)
bzero(t->lp[i], t->nc);
t->r = t->c = 0;
restorecurs(t);
}
void
xt_move(t, r, c) /* move to new position */
register TEXTWIND *t;
int r, c;
{
if (r < 0 || c < 0 || r >= t->nr || c >= t->nc)
return;
checkcurs(t);
t->r = r;
t->c = c;
restorecurs(t);
}
int
xt_cursor(t, curs) /* change cursor */
register TEXTWIND *t;
register int curs;
{
register int oldcurs;
if (curs != TNOCURS && curs != TBLKCURS)
return(-1);
oldcurs = t->cursor;
if (curs != oldcurs)
togglecurs(t);
t->cursor = curs;
return(oldcurs);
}
void
xt_close(t) /* close text window */
register TEXTWIND *t;
{
register int i;
XFreeFont(t->dpy, t->f);
XFreeGC(t->dpy,t->gc);
XDestroyWindow(t->dpy, t->w);
for (i = 0; i < t->nr; i++)
free(t->lp[i]);
free((void *)t->lp);
free((void *)t);
}
static void
togglecurs(t)
register TEXTWIND *t;
{
XSetFunction(t->dpy, t->gc, GXinvert);
XSetPlaneMask(t->dpy, t->gc, 1L);
XFillRectangle(t->dpy, t->w, t->gc,
t->c*Width(t->f)+LEFTMAR, t->r*Height(t->f),
Width(t->f), Height(t->f));
XSetFunction(t->dpy, t->gc, GXcopy);
XSetPlaneMask(t->dpy, t->gc, ~0L);
}
